Millions of us attach these little monitors onto our wrists and keep them on all day and night, seemingly unconcerned with the fact they're constantly tracking us.
Gone are the days when we relied on them solely to give us an estimation of our step count. Today, they can analyse our sleep quality, blood pressure, oxygen saturation, our body battery.
It's a challenge to find a bodily function they don't track.
But are they able to do what they advertise? And are the data points we obsess over a true reflection of our actual health? Do they boost our mental and physical wellbeing, or do the avalanche of readings and cheerleading alerts just contribute to our sense of overwhelm?
A Love-Hate Relationship
"I find myself getting a a little obsessed with mine," one user reveals.
While she appreciates how her device records her runs, she finds some of its other functions "daunting" at times - a feeling first discovered during a major life event.
Until she found out she could adjust the settings, her smartwatch kept telling her she was failing to be energetic enough. In a new phase, the watch frequently reports her she's had a poor sleep score.
"I've got a infant, there's no point to be notified I'm tired," she says. "I know that only too well."
Why doesn't she just remove it?
"I could, I suppose, but I've got this push-pull dynamic with it," she explains. "I love it for its fitness insights, but I'm unsure whether all the other things it can now do is maybe overkill for me."
The Technology Behind the Tracking
Every device of smartwatch has its own novel way of measuring your vitals and interpreting your data, but the most use optical sensors on the reverse of the watch.
They typically shine tiny, coloured LED lights onto your arm which can monitor blood flow, detecting your heartbeat. Higher-end devices measure changes in the electrical current that runs through the skin to assess your stress levels.
A Fine Balance
One expert says that for most people for smartwatches, it's a "fine balance" - while the ever-evolving tech could potentially save lives, "spotting abnormalities before we feel unwell", it could also turn us the tracked into the "worried well".
He points out that the most advanced wearables can carry out tests like heart rhythm analysis, which regularly monitor how stable the heart is. They can alert if someone is experiencing an irregular rhythm, where there is irregular electrical activity in the heart causing an uneven pulse.
This does not mean someone is imminently going to suffer a cardiac event, but it can give an preliminary indication they might be more vulnerable of a heart problem in the future.
But how to understand these readings is complicated. The expert concerns that as additional features are added, people may find it hard to fully understand their data.
"I'm not entirely convinced that being able to monitor so many metrics is such a positive development," he says.
A clinical psychologist focusing on patient behaviour echoes this sentiment. Her work into the influence of wearable tech on a specific group of heart condition patients suggested a noticeable percentage of those who were given devices to monitor their cardiac function experienced greater stress and were "had a higher tendency to use healthcare resources".
She noted a vicious circle with her patients - they noticed a worrying figure on their watch. They felt anxious. Their pulse rose. They got increasingly anxious. They looked a second time, and their heart rate rose further.
"If we see stats about ourselves that we lack context for then, of course, we are going to become concerned," the psychologist says. "We monitor, we re-check - it becomes a feedback loop."
